What Is a Factorial?
The factorial of a positive integer \( n \), denoted \( n! \), is the product of all positive integers from 1 to \( n \). Mathematically,
\[
n! = n \ imes (n-1) \ imes (n-2) \ imes \cdots \ imes 2 \ imes 1
\]
- For example:
\( 5! = 5 \ imes 4 \ imes 3 \ imes 2 \ imes 1 = 120 \)
\( 4! = 4 \ imes 3 \ imes 2 \ imes 1 = 24 \)
\( 10! = 10 \ imes 9 \ imes \cdots \ imes 1 = 3,628,800 \)
\( 1! = 1 \) (by definition)

Breaking Down the Key Examples
1. \( 10! = 3,628,800 \)
Calculating \( 10! \) means multiplying all integers from 1 to 10. This large factorial often appears in statistical formulas, such as combinations:
\[
\binom{10}{5} = \frac{10!}{5! \ imes 5!} = 252
\]
Choosing 5 items from 10 without regard to order relies heavily on factorial math.

2. \( 4! = 24 \)
\( 4! \) is one of the simplest factorial calculations and often used in permutations:
\[
P(4, 4) = 4! = 24
\]
This tells us there are 24 ways to arrange 4 distinct items in order—useful in scheduling, cryptography, and data arrangements.
3. \( 5! = 120 \)
Another commonly referenced factorial, \( 5! \), appears in factorial-based algorithms and mathematical equations such as:
\[
n! = \ ext{number of permutations of } n \ ext{ items}
\]
For \( 5! = 120 \), it’s a handy middle-point example between small numbers and larger factorials.
4. \( 1! = 1 \)
Defined as 1, \( 1! \) might seem trivial, but it forms the base case for recursive factorial definitions. Importantly:
\[
n! = n \ imes (n-1)! \quad \ ext{so} \quad 1! = 1 \ imes 0! \Rightarrow 0! = 1
\]
This recursive property ensures consistency across all factorial values.
